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$708 per month in Porlamar vs $686 in San Cristobal,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,134 per month in Porlamar vs $1,107 in San Cristobal, rent included.

A family of three spends $1,560 per month in Porlamar vs $1,528 in San Cristobal, rent included.

Porlamar costs about 3% more than San Cristobal, driven mainly by Clothing & Footwear.

Both Porlamar and San Cristobal are more affordable than the global median – Porlamar 48% lower, San Cristobal 50% lower.
